How to change system time zone in Windows programmatically

I’ve been writing software that allows to change the current time zone parameters used in Windows. This kinda stuff: The only reference to setting a system-wide time zone that I found was the SetTimeZoneInformation API (or its variation SetDynamicTimeZoneInformation.) But I wasn’t really sure how I can use it to change the current time zone. For instance, itContinue reading “How to change system time zone in Windows programmatically”

How to preserve reputation with the Windows 10 SmartScreen Filter after code-signing certificate renewal

I had a code-signing certificate for the last 3 years. When I signed my software with it, the signature did not cause any SmartScreen warnings when the software was downloaded from the Internet. This certificate was expiring this month, so I renewed it with the same company for another 3 years. But now my signed software isContinue reading “How to preserve reputation with the Windows 10 SmartScreen Filter after code-signing certificate renewal”

Design a site like this with WordPress.com
Get started